This component usually lays out a specific process for responding to an incident together with requiring a written report, timeline for decision, documentation of decision, and family notification. In addition to varieties for reporting, many anti-racist/equity policies require a racism logbook or place for complaints to be recorded completely. These policies additionally describe methods by which schools might help college students who could also be victims of a racist or discriminatory act. Some insurance policies notice that assist for students concerned in an incident should be ongoing and matched with psychological or psychological well being services. Additionally, some policies encourage faculties to help college students really feel empowered to report incidents and develop methods for dealing with racial conflict. In some cases this is the superintendent or another school leader; in other contexts, an equity committee is charged with this responsibility. For instance, in Shaker Heights, Ohio there’s an equity task pressure made up of eleven educators, 9 community members, and two students. In basic, the governing physique or individual is required to report back to the varsity board, make recommendations based on data, promote alignment between equity and other goals, current instruments or sources, and guarantee compliance with state and federal laws. Most policies describe the necessity for an annual report or evaluate as part of their motion plan. To be racially prejudiced means to have an unfavorable or discriminatory attitude or perception in the direction of someone else or one other group of people primarily on the idea of pores and skin color or ethnicity. For example, John is prejudiced as a result of he believes that the new Hmong refugees in his group are stupid and barbaric as a end result of they kill chickens in their yard. The above encounter at the restaurant is an instance of racial prejudice. Redlining , which is in opposition to the law, is an act of racism or institutionalized prejudice. It is necessary to understand the excellence between racial prejudice and racism as a outcome of they’re affected in another way by issues associated to energy and, therefore, require totally different levels of involvement and effort to handle.
